Intel m5-7Y54 vs AMD R-464L APU

The Intel Core m5-7Y54 @ 1.20GHz is newer than AMD R-464L APU, while AMD R-464L APU is around 17% faster in multi-threaded (CPU Mark) testing, it is around 34% faster in single-thread testing. The CPUs selected in this comparison belong in different CPU Classes: Mobile/Embedded, Laptop. Consider, selecting CPUs from simliar CPU Class for more apt comparison.The values below were tabulated from a combined 13 benchmarks submitted from our PerformanceTest software and results and are updated daily to include new submissions.
